I actually use this app everyday. You need to find a cool place to eat? Something exciting to do? Want to find some culture in a new place? Or looking for a last minute reservation? This is the place to find it. Everything on the app is curated and recommended by professionals, you will only have good experiences at the places it recommends. You can also see where your friends go, save places you look or want to go, and create a digital archive of all the places you go on life’s journey!
